Winter Fuel U-turn: EU Agreement Unveils Crucial Details for Vulnerable Households

Record-high energy prices and a looming winter crisis have led to a dramatic U-turn in EU energy policy. After months of heated debate and intense pressure from member states facing widespread fuel poverty, a new agreement has been reached, offering crucial support to vulnerable households struggling to heat their homes this winter. This article breaks down the key details of this landmark deal.

<h3>A Lifeline for Millions: Key Provisions of the New EU Agreement</h3>

The newly announced agreement represents a significant shift from the EU's initial approach to the energy crisis. Instead of focusing solely on long-term solutions, the deal prioritizes immediate relief for citizens struggling with soaring energy bills. Key provisions include:

  • Direct Financial Assistance: The agreement earmarks a substantial fund to provide direct financial aid to households below a certain income threshold. The specific amount will vary depending on the member state, but the aim is to ensure a minimum level of support across the EU. This represents a crucial step towards tackling fuel poverty and protecting the most vulnerable members of society. Further details on eligibility criteria and application processes are expected to be released by individual member states in the coming weeks.

  • Energy Efficiency Upgrades: Recognizing that long-term solutions are vital, the agreement also commits significant funds to improving energy efficiency in homes across Europe. This includes grants and subsidies for insulation, window replacements, and the installation of energy-efficient heating systems. These upgrades will not only reduce energy consumption and bills in the long term but also create jobs in the green energy sector. Information on accessing these programs will be disseminated through national and regional government channels.

  • Price Caps and Subsidies: While a complete EU-wide price cap remains controversial, the agreement allows member states greater flexibility to implement targeted price caps or subsidies on energy bills. This will allow countries to tailor their support to their specific circumstances and the needs of their population. Several countries have already announced plans to utilize this provision.

  • Increased Transparency and Consumer Protection: The agreement emphasizes the need for greater transparency in energy pricing and stronger consumer protection measures. This includes stricter regulations on energy providers and improved tools for consumers to compare energy tariffs and identify the best deals. This is a crucial step towards empowering consumers and preventing exploitation during times of crisis.

<h3>Addressing Criticisms and Looking Ahead</h3>

While the agreement has been largely welcomed, some criticisms remain. Concerns have been raised about the speed of implementation and the potential for bureaucratic delays in distributing aid. Furthermore, the long-term effectiveness of the measures will depend on the successful implementation of energy efficiency upgrades and the continued commitment of member states to sustainable energy policies.

The European Commission has promised to closely monitor the rollout of the program and address any emerging challenges. Further announcements are expected in the coming weeks, detailing specific national implementation plans and providing clarity on eligibility criteria and application processes.
